Hurricanes are the most violent storms on Earth. They form near the equator over warm ocean waters. Actually, the term hurricane is used only for the large storms that form over the Atlantic Ocean or eastern Pacific Ocean. The generic, scientific term for these storms, wherever they occur, is tropical cyclone.

<span>After considerable debate and alteration, the Articles of Confederation were adopted by the Continental Congress on November 15, 1777. This document served as the United States' first constitution, and was in force from March 1, 1781, until 1789 when the present day Constitution went into effect.</span>
Removal of current or future unpleasant consequences to increase the likelihood that someone will repeat a behavior is called negative reinforcement.
Negative reinforcement is a technique for teaching specific behaviors. In response to a stimulus, something unpleasant or uncomfortable is taken away with negative reinforcement. With the expectation that the unpleasant thing will be removed, the target behavior should increase over time.
One of the most effective forms of negative reinforcement in schools could be the removal of homework in response to excellent work ethic. If a child works exceptionally hard in school one day and goes above and beyond, an appropriate response would be to give that child a night off from homework.
